Wizard (Imperial Humans Substitution Level)

Imperial Wizard Substitution Levels

Note: Only Imperial Humans are eligible for these.

Table: The Imperial Wizard

Hit Die: d4

Level Base
Attack Bonus
Saving Throws Special
FortRefWill
1st+0+0+0+2 Imperial Dictum, Scribe Scrolls
5th+2+1+1+4 Armored Mage (Light)
10th+5+3+3+7 Armored Mage (Medium)
15th+7/+2+5+5+9 Armored Mage (Shield)
20th+10/+5+6+6+12 Armored Mage (Heavy)

Imperial Dictum: Wizard are officers and negotiator of the Imperial Army. They are adept at diplomacy and art of aristocracy. Diplomacy is alway a class skill (no matter the class) and the Imperial Wizard gain a competence bonus equal to half his wizard level to this particular check. The Imperial Wizard may trade diplomacy for bluff.

Armored Mage: At 5th level, the wizard may ignore Arcane Spell Failure granted by Light armor.

At 10th level, the wizard may ignore the Arcane Spell Failure granted by Medium Armor.

At 15th level, the Imperial wizard may ignore the Arcane Spell failure granted by Shield.

At 20th level, the Imperial wizard may ignore the Arcane Spell Failure granted by heavy armor.
